A right triangle includes one angle that mesures 30 degrees. What is the measure of the third angle?

Answer:

The  third angle is 60°

Step-by-step explanation:

Properties of right triangle.

1) One angle should be 90°

2) Hypotenuse² = Base² + Height²

<u>To find the third angle</u>

It is given that, one angle of right triangle measures 30°.

One angle is 90°

By using angle sum property we can find third angle.

Let third angle be 'x', then we can write

x + 30 + 90 = 180

x + 120 = 180

x = 180 - 120 = 60

Therefore third angle is 60°

What is the exact distance from (−5, 1) to (3, 0)? (4 points)
kirza4 [7]

Answer:

The exact distance from (−5, 1) to (3, 0) is of \sqrt{65} units

Step-by-step explanation:

Suppose we have two points:

A = (x_{1}, y_{1})

B = (x_{2}, y_{2})

The distance between these points is, in units:

D = \sqrt{(x_{2} - x_{1})^{2} + (y_{2} - y_{1})^{2}}

Distance from (−5, 1) to (3, 0)?

D = \sqrt{(3 - (-5))^{2} + (0 - 1)^{2}} = \sqrt{64 + 1} = \sqrt{65}

The exact distance from (−5, 1) to (3, 0) is of \sqrt{65} units
